Shed Painting Service in Longmont, CO
Shed painting services involve applying fresh coats of paint to enhance the appearance and protect the exterior of garden sheds, storage buildings, or similar structures on resid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including repainting existing sheds, updating weathered or faded surfaces, and applying new finishes to improve durability and curb appeal.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of preparation work involved, such as cleaning, sanding, or priming, as well as the types of paint suitable for outdoor use to ensure long-lasting results.
Before requesting shed painting services, homeowners often consider factors like the condition of the existing surface, the material of the shed, and the desired color or finish.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project includes repairs or surface prep work, and to inquire about the recommended paints and coatings for outdoor exposure. Understanding these details can help ensure the finished result meets expectations and provides lasting protection against the elements.

Shed Painting Service Questions
What types of sheds can be painted? The service can be applied to wooden, metal, and vinyl sheds to enhance appearance and protection.
Is prep work included in shed painting? Yes, surfaces are cleaned, sanded, and primed to ensure proper paint adhesion and durability.
Can shed painting improve the weather resistance? Applying a fresh coat of paint can help protect the shed from moisture and weather-related damage.
What finishes are available for shed painting? A variety of finishes, including matte, semi-gloss, and gloss, are available to match the desired look and function.
